Home
VOLVO
XC60
2012
YV4940DZ5C2241305
2012 VOLVO XC60 3.2L PREMIER PZEV vin: YV4940DZ5C2241305
2021-05-14 (17 photos) Odometer: 93895
Unlock these pics for $2.99